Meticulous Research®– a leading global market research company published a research report titled Automotive TIC market by service type (testing, inspection, certification), sourcing (in-house and outsourcing), application (vehicle inspection, electric components and electronics, OEM testing, telematics), and geography - global forecast to 2025”.


According to this latest publication from Meticulous Research®, the global automotive testing, inspection, certification market is forecasted to reach $32.7 billion in 2025 from USD 22.5 billion in 2019, growing at a CAGR of 6.4%. The growth of this market is driven by factors such as growing automotive production worldwide, consumer awareness about safety and environment, and technological advancements. Moreover, small scale and medium sized business and potential for small cars in the emerging market are the factors providing opportunities in this market. On the other hand, stringent trade policies and regulations, high time required to perform overseas qualification tests, lack of skilled resources, and government and environmental regulations are expected to hinder the growth of this market.


The global automotive testing, inspection, certification market study presents historical market data in terms of values (2017 and 2018), estimated current data (2019), and forecasts for 2025- by Service Type (Testing, Inspection, Certification), Sourcing (In-house and Outsourcing), and Application (Vehicle Inspection Services, Electric Components and Electronics, Interior & Exterior Materials and Components, Electro Mobility/ Electric Vehicles, Automotive Fuels, Fluids, and Lubricants, Homologation Testing, Advanced Driver Assistance Systems testing, Durability Testing, OEM Testing, Telematics, Emission testing, Acoustic Testing, Others). The study also evaluates industry competitors and analyzes the market at regional and country level.

Based on service type, the global automotive TIC market is segmented into testing, inspection, and certification. Testing services segment accounted for the largest share of global automotive TIC market in 2018, owing to growing demand for high quality and safety products and strong recommendations from the regulatory authorities to ensure the safety, quality, and efficiency of the products. However, telematics segment is expected to grow at fastest growth rate owing to growing interest among automotive manufacturers to design vehicles using telecommunications.


On the basis of sourcing, automotive TIC market is segmented into in-house and outsourcing. In-house segment accounted for the largest share of global automotive testing, inspection, certification market in 2018 as it maintains higher visibility and higher degree of control over processes, which further improves the delivery performance.


This research report analyzes major geographies and provides comprehensive analysis of North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, Latin America, and Middle East & Africa. Asia Pacific accounted for the largest share of global automotive TIC services market in 2018. Factors such as strong support from the government to promote the development of automotive industry, rising focus of manufacturers to support innovative research and expand their position in this region, increasing investments/funds from the manufacturers and government in automotive industry are expected to drive the growth of the automotive TIC services market in this region.


The key players profiled in the global automotive testing, inspection, certification market report are Dekra Se, SGS, Applus, Eurofins Scientific, TUV Rheinland AG Group, TUV SUD SGS, Bureau Veritas, TÜV NORD Group, and Element Materials Technology.
